The 28/2.8 PC Super Angulon R does not appear on the usual R lens menu when the R-M adapter is mounted on the M240. This is not at all surprising since it would be impossible to generate any suitable in-camera corrections, since any such corrections would depend completely on the magnitude and direction of any shift applied. However, this picture shows that with lens selection switched off, results are still reasonable. I've deliberately done absolutely nothing to the in camera .jpg file, apart from rescaling to suitable Forum dimensions.
